This weeks episode The Hills is one of the most drama filled episodes of season 5! Heidi is back from Colorado and still mad at Spencer for taking shots and flirting with Stacie. Spencer is over the drama, Heidi wants to go to therapy, it's a big ol mess for Speidi! Lauren is also put in a sticky situation when Stephanie interviews for a position at People's Revolution. I also break down the more recent fight that happened between Kelly Cutrone and Stephanie Pratt!
Other Topics: Lorde, Ben & JLo, Zoe & Channing, Kacey Musgraves, Little Mix, Drama Queens Podcast, Dealing with anxiety, and more!
